Technical lab assistant, electronic-optical interfaces - DTU Electro
Job Description

We are looking for a motivated AC Bachelor to contribute to the development and implementation of a computer-controlled measurement interface for research applications. In this role, you will work closely with researchers and technical specialists to support the establishment of a new experimental setup, combining technical development with analytical and project-oriented tasks.

The job
Your responsibilities will include:

  • Developing and programming interfaces for measurement and laboratory equipment
  • Testing, validating, and documenting system solutions and experimental setups
  • Analyzing measurement results and supporting the optimization of technical workflows
  • Coordinating activities related to the setup and operation of research experiments
  • Collaborating with researchers to translate technical requirements into practical solutions
  • Contributing to project planning, reporting, and technical documentation

The position is a fixed term position for 1 year (10 hours per week) starting September 1, 2026.

The workplace is DTU Lyngby Campus.

DTU – For the benefit of society since 1829
DTU is one of Europe's leading elite technical universities. Through research and education at an international top level, we create solutions to the major societal challenges of our time and help secure Europe's global leadership in sustainable technological development. Since Hans Christian Ørsted founded DTU almost 200 years ago, our mission has remained the same: We develop and create value through the natural and technical sciences for the benefit of society. DTU has 13,800 students, 1,600 PhD students, and 6,500 employees. We work in an international environment and have an inclusive, stimulating, and informal work culture. DTU has campuses in all parts of Denmark and in Greenland and collaborates with the best universities around the world.
